Description

This opening is for Rule 9 Interns who are interested in working in either our Criminal or Civil Divisions. Rule 9 Interns may be in an externship receiving credit through their law school or may apply for the internship without receiving school credit. Students can select to work in either our Criminal or Civil Divisions. The job duties outlined below may vary based on which division you work in. Our Criminal Rule 9 Interns must have a valid drivers license and vehicle, as some travel may be required to outlying district courts. Our Civil Division Rule 9 Interns do not need to have a valid drivers license or vehicle. Applications for Rule 9 positions will first be considered on September 15, 2026, then on a rolling basis until positions are filled.

1L law students may also apply for unpaid internships at our office. Applications for 1L Intern positions will first be considered on January 18, 2027, and then on a rolling basis.

BASIC FUNCTION

Provide internship opportunities for law students at the end of their first and second year of law school.

Job Duties

STATEMENT OF ESSENTIAL INTERNSHIP DUTIES

  • Handle infractions calendars, criminal arraignments, show cause hearings, criminal motions, and trial work under the supervision of a practicing attorney.

  • Assist with researching and writing appeals in Snohomish County Superior Court and the Court of Appeals.

  • Draft initial responses to post-conviction motions involving restoration of constitutional rights and vacating of convictions.

  • Handle Involuntary Treatment Act hearings, civil motions and supporting declarations.

  • Draft discovery responses and attend or conduct depositions.

  • Conduct legal research, prepare written work product for attorneys and clients, draft external communications conveying legal position.

Minimum Qualifications

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S - FOR RULE 9 INTERNS

Must be able to show proof of enrollment in an accredited post-secondary institution at the time of the Internship. If the Internship occurs during the summer, the student may either provide proof of summer or fall enrollment.

Must be a licensed Rule 9 Intern with the State of Washington in an accredited law program working towards a Juris Doctorate.

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S

Law students must have completed their second year of law school (or equivalent credit hours).
